"If nothing else works, go for a ride."
I heard this advice recently, and I couldn’t agree more—I’d wholeheartedly pass it on to my friends and family!
Babies sometimes struggle to settle themselves, and a car ride can work wonders. The snug fit of the car seat, the rhythmic hum of the engine, and the gentle motion all seem to have a soothing effect. There have been many times when, after trying everything else, I’ve buckled up my little one, gone for a drive, and watched as they finally relaxed and drifted off to sleep.
But this advice isn’t just for the baby—it’s for the parents, too. When you’re feeling stressed, your back aches from endless rocking, and you’re in desperate need of a break, a ride can be a simple but powerful reset. Driving to grab a coffee while listening to your favorite podcast or music can be nourishing, even if your baby doesn’t fall asleep. Sometimes, it’s about taking a moment for yourself while giving your baby a change of scenery.
So if nothing else seems to work, give it a try. You might find that a car ride isn’t just a solution for the baby—it’s a little gift for you, too.
